Project Forum of the Seminar for Communication Studies with the public presentation of the current PSP projects. Interested parties are cordially invited.

Programme:
1:30 p.m. champagne reception in front of lecture hall 1 of the Communication and Information Center (KIZ). 
2 p.m. Opening with greetings from the Seminar for Media and Communication Studies and Michael Tallai (FUNKE Medien Thüringen). Afterwards, this year's project groups will present their results.

The topics this year are:

  • EXPRESS YOURSELF – To what extent does the individual opinion of German social media users change by writing comments?
  • An investigation of antagonists over time 
  • The presentation of sexual education and prevention content on selected Instagram channels and its perception by user:s
  • Cancellation Culture in the University Context – To What Extent Does the Phenomenon of Cancel Culture Restrict Academic Freedom at Universities in Germany?
  • Media Competence Promotion – A Project for a More Conscious Dealing with Disinformation and Deepfakes on the Net
  • Refugees in the Media: An Empirical Investigation of TV Coverage and its Contribution to the Audience's Attitude of Solidarity
